Research On Application Of Rough Set Attribute Reduction Methods In Medical Diagnosis

Now the hospital has accumulated vast amounts of medical diagnostic data, utilization of a large amount of data using advanced information processing technology has become an important direction of the development of medical. At present the method of medical diagnosis is mainly based on the diagnosis to the patient’s symptoms. But with the increasing of the types of diseases, the interference of symptoms is greatly enhanced, which brings great burden to the doctor. In this paper, through the analyzing of the problem of medical diagnostic and the attribute reduction algorithm based on rough set, two kinds of attribute reduction algorithm is proposed for medical diagnosis. The main work is as follows:1) In view of the problem that the same weight of the attributes is often occurred in the results obtained by the HORAFA algorithm and other existing improved algorithm. According to the features of medical diagnostic data, a new heuristic reduction algorithm based on discernibility matrix is put forward by improving the heuristic rules and the attribute deletion operation of the algorithm. The experimental results show that the algorithm can improve the efficiency of reduction and obtain better reduction.2) A new kind of adaptive genetic reduction algorithm is put forward in order to solve the attribute reduction problem of large-scale medical diagnostic data. The improved attribute weights is used to construct individual fitness function. The new optimal selection strategy is used to enrich the types of community, to avoid local extremum. The concept of attribute similarity is used to reduce the redundant operation of crossover and the calculation number of fitness function. Improving the mutation operation is to avoid that attributes with the same weight exist in each individual. Experiments show that the algorithm is more suitable for the information system which has a large amount of data.3) Genetic reduction algorithm is applied to the reduction of the 2 diabetes mellitus data, to extract the key symptoms, to assist process of diagnose, and to reduce the rate of misdiagnosis and missed diagnosis...
